What Is Plexiglass & Acrylic Printing and Why Use UV Flatbeds?

Plexiglass and acrylic printing involves applying durable images directly onto transparent or translucent sheets using UV flatbed printers, which cure ink instantly for vibrant, scratch-resistant results on rigid substrates up to 100mm thick.

Plexiglass, also known as acrylic or PMMA, is a lightweight, shatter-resistant alternative to glass widely used in signage, home decor, displays, and custom gifts. UV flatbed printing excels here because it deposits UV-curable ink layer-by-layer onto flat surfaces, bonding permanently without heat or solvents. This method supports thick media from 1-100mm, handles uneven edges, and delivers production speeds over 100 sqm/hr on industrial models.

Unlike screen printing, which requires stencils and drying time, or inkjet on paper followed by mounting, UV flatbeds print directly for edge-to-edge coverage. Which Acrylic Printing Techniques Achieve Crystal-Clear Transparency?

Check: Plexiglass & Acrylic Printing

Six key techniques—direct printing, reverse printing, backlit printing, transparent color, color-white-color, and double-side printing—leverage UV flatbeds to maintain acrylic's clarity while adding vibrant designs, using white ink layers and varnish for opacity control.

Direct printing applies CMYK inks face-up for standard viewing, preserving surface gloss. Reverse printing mirrors the image on the back, viewed through the clear front for a floating effect ideal for displays. Backlit printing uses white underlayers with bright colors for illuminated signs, enhancing glow without hotspots.

Transparent color mode skips white ink for see-through designs, perfect for overlays. Color-white-color sandwiches white between layers for depth and vibrancy on clear acrylic. Double-side printing coats both surfaces simultaneously on dual-head systems. AndresJet models like the AJ2130G/R support all these via 8-color configurations (CMYK + LC + LM + White + Varnish), with resolutions up to 720x1200 dpi and auto media height detection up to 100mm.

For crystal-clear results, prep acrylic by cleaning with isopropyl alcohol, then use ICC-based color profiles in RIIN Print or PhotoPrint RIP software for accurate transparency.

How Does White Ink Enable Vibrant Opaque Finishes on Plexiglass?

White ink creates an opaque base layer on clear plexiglass, preventing color bleed-through and boosting saturation; layered as white-CMYK or color-white-color, it delivers vivid opaque finishes while varnish adds gloss matching acrylic's natural shine.

On transparent acrylic, standard CMYK inks appear washed out due to light refraction. White ink, circulated via dual negative pressure systems, prints first as a solid blocker, making subsequent colors pop with full opacity. AndresJet printers like AJ2130G/R and AJ3220G/R include dedicated white channels, enabling raised effects and multi-layer builds up to 0.15mm in select configurations.

For backlit applications, white ink diffuses light evenly. Varnish overcoats seal designs, mimicking plexiglass sheen and protecting against scratches. With RICOH Gen5/Gen6 printheads, these printers achieve precise drop-on-demand placement at 360x1200 dpi or higher, ensuring no pinholes in white layers.

How to Troubleshoot Common Plexiglass UV Printing Defects?

Address ink adhesion by pre-cleaning with IPA; fix UV cure inconsistencies via LED calibration; resolve edge quality with vacuum zoning and anti-static bars on AndresJet flatbeds for defect-free plexiglass prints.

Common issues: poor adhesion (solution: flame plasma treatment); over/under-cure (adjust UV intensity); pinholes in white (circulate ink, clean heads). Use auto height detection and fiber optics for alignment.
